Viacheslav Hletenko
d0649cf3b5
T5415: upgrade libyang library to v2.1.128
2023-10-30 20:41:25 +00:00
Christian Breunig
3ff0f40fdf
Merge pull request #377 from tjjh89017/arm64
...
arm64 build vyos kernel for qemu vm and rpi4
2023-08-24 16:13:03 +02:00
John Estabrook
135c6236f0
Docker: T5500: update commit ref for vyos1x-config
2023-08-23 08:57:46 -05:00
Date Huang
55d5d10550
T5499: arm64: build jool with correct depends
...
Signed-off-by: Date Huang <tjjh89017@hotmail.com>
2023-08-22 22:44:32 +08:00
Christian Breunig
9e2ba40939
frr: T5415: upgrade libyang library to v2.1.80
2023-08-01 20:54:17 +02:00
John Estabrook
65148fc776
Docker: T5317: update commit refs for vyos1x-config and libvyosconfig
2023-07-28 10:58:37 -05:00
John Estabrook
65a930ebef
Docker: T5194: update commit ref for vyos1x-config
2023-07-25 14:19:41 -05:00
John Estabrook
9d35b40343
Docker: T5385: update commit ref for vyos1x-config
2023-07-21 09:38:39 -05:00
Christian Breunig
dac7ac026e
Docker: T5286: Kernel depends on libelf-dev - add missing dependency
...
Commit dd194c6e8 ("Docker: T5286: remove XDP support") dropped all relevant
package build dependencies for XDP - which is good as we should not carry
leftovers.
The Linux Kernel dependency list in contrast always lacked this package. Re-add
the package to the appropriate section.
2023-06-14 06:02:12 +02:00
Christian Breunig
dd194c6e80
Docker: T5286: remove XDP support
2023-06-12 20:00:22 +02:00
Viacheslav Hletenko
606e96d184
Docker: T5241: add jmespath dependency to vyos-1x
...
The validation 'is_intf_addr_assigned' will be rewritten to support 'netns' and
will use jmespath that required for build .deb pkg to validate
'vyos-1x/src/tests/test_validate.py'.
2023-06-03 07:45:22 +02:00
John Estabrook
ac8aee9e2c
Docker: T5194: update commit refs for vyos1x-config and libvyosconfig
2023-05-16 13:52:23 -05:00
John Estabrook
abb3345625
Docker: T5194: add OCaml package xml-light as build dependency
2023-05-16 13:46:35 -05:00
zsdc
d9f711f500
jool: T160: Added scripts to build jool package
...
Added dependencies and build scripts for
https://github.com/NICMx/Jool/
2023-05-01 23:29:05 +03:00
John Estabrook
74c0094610
Docker: T5185: update commit refs for vyos1x-config
2023-04-26 13:15:34 -05:00
John Estabrook
c3f11ba39c
Docker: T5089: update commit refs for vyos1x-config and libvyosconfig
2023-03-29 09:48:04 -05:00
Christian Breunig
eec4616cf8
Docker: T5076: Intel QAT drivers rely on libudev-dev
...
Package was previously side-loaded by another dependency.
2023-03-14 18:47:29 +01:00
Christian Breunig
f9477ebea7
Docker: T5076: unbloat container - remove dependencies for pam_tacplus
2023-03-11 21:45:17 +01:00
Christian Breunig
51f21e1f25
Docker: T5076: unbloat container - remove dependencies for sstp-client
...
Package consumed via Debian upstream
2023-03-11 21:08:07 +01:00
Christian Breunig
759a37ed6a
Docker: T5076: unbloat container - remove dependencies for vyos-http-api-tools
2023-03-11 21:07:41 +01:00
Christian Breunig
58b2387de6
Docker: T5076: unbloat container - remove dependencies for libnss-mapuser & libpam-radius
2023-03-11 21:07:26 +01:00
Christian Breunig
40e5b0510b
Docker: T5076: unbloat container - remove obsolete dh-exec package
2023-03-11 21:07:08 +01:00
Christian Breunig
193c86f92a
Docker: T5076: unbloat container - remove dependencies for fastnetmon
...
Package consumed from Debian upstream
2023-03-11 21:03:05 +01:00
Christian Breunig
06ff3bf19a
Docker: T5076: unbloat container - remove dependencies for ipaddrcheck
2023-03-11 21:01:51 +01:00
Christian Breunig
37c2166955
Docker: T5076: unbloat container - remove dependencies for wide-dhcpv6
2023-03-11 21:00:53 +01:00
Christian Breunig
d6dda023ad
Docker: T5076: unbloat container - remove dependencies for hvinfo
2023-03-11 20:58:03 +01:00
Christian Breunig
bf8180ecfb
Docker: T5076: unbloat container - remove dependencies for vyatta-cfg
2023-03-11 20:57:50 +01:00
Christian Breunig
2fae141062
Docker: T5076: unbloat container - remove dependencies for frr
2023-03-11 20:37:37 +01:00
Christian Breunig
ad69d72482
Docker: T5076: use Debian python3-inotify package
2023-03-11 20:29:22 +01:00
Christian Breunig
3e051f8f12
Docker: T5076: merge opam re package installation with other packages
2023-03-11 20:28:27 +01:00
Christian Breunig
d67bfec4d8
Docker: fix vim mouse disable command for bookworm - which uses dash
2023-03-11 13:01:40 +01:00
Christian Breunig
74173b1ba5
Docker: T5076: unbloat container - remove dependencies for keepalived
2023-03-10 22:17:40 +01:00
Christian Breunig
69c585bc26
Docker: T5076: install packages from pip instead of Github source
2023-03-10 22:15:15 +01:00
Christian Breunig
f163deaf36
Docker: T5076: unbloat container - remove dependencies for hostap
2023-03-10 21:38:49 +01:00
Christian Breunig
1af87a7749
Docker: T5076: unbloat container - remove dependencies for dropbear
2023-03-10 21:36:54 +01:00
Christian Breunig
30c2f9af0b
Docker: T5076: unbloat container - remove dependencies for strongswan
2023-03-09 20:09:09 +01:00
Christian Breunig
247b44ef7c
Docker: VyOS moved to FRR and no longer require vyatta-quagga
2023-03-09 20:09:09 +01:00
Christian Breunig
c7b2a40eca
Docker: T2842: drop build dependency on wireguard tools
...
As of commit 1175a62b3464 ("WireGuard: T2842: switch to binary package from
buster-backports") we rely on the distributed binary package from Debian and no
longer need the build requirements.
2023-03-09 20:09:09 +01:00
Christian Breunig
c95619b3d8
Docker: T2199: T3873: drop dependencies for vyatta-cfg-firewall
2023-03-09 20:09:09 +01:00
sarthurdev
7b1b408888
docker: T5003: Use Debian package for yq, fix pip installs, fix open-vmdk build
...
* Add zlib1g-dev package for open-vmdk build
Debian have updated python3-pip to prevent system-wide installs (PEP 668)
* Adds and uses `pipx` that will install dependencies within a venv where appropriate
* Use `--break-system-packages` argument for j2lint
2023-02-23 01:20:16 +01:00
Yuriy Andamasov
5aae6a44a7
Merge pull request #314 from sarthurdev/bookworm
...
docker: T5003: Re-add build deps for wpa/hostap
2023-02-23 00:31:28 +01:00
sarthurdev
041be49f7e
debian: T5003: Re-add build deps for wpa/hostap
2023-02-22 23:10:17 +01:00
Christian Breunig
139e8dc63b
Docker: T5003: add missing libelf-dev dependency for FRR (fix arm64 builds)
2023-02-21 20:16:09 +01:00
sarthurdev
dd29ea0bac
debian: T5003: Re-add chown on vyos_bld home directory
...
Removed accidentally in commit 41033fa
2023-02-21 17:58:36 +01:00
sarthurdev
1ac06d883f
debian: T5003: Use upstream libi2util to fix OWAMP build issue
2023-02-21 15:54:12 +01:00
sarthurdev
213418f181
debian: T5003: Fix FRR build using old version of Sphinx
2023-02-21 14:47:31 +01:00
sarthurdev
41033fae9a
debian: T5003: Fix docker entrypoint
2023-02-21 13:14:20 +01:00
Christian Breunig
632dce27c2
Docker: T5003: can no longer change non-interactive shell to bash
2023-02-20 20:01:23 +01:00
sarthurdev
1e116e0254
debian: T5003: Update to to Debian 12 "Bookworm"
...
* Remove obsolete packages and dependencies
2023-02-13 11:20:49 +01:00
John Estabrook
b00c41e6a5
Docker: T4991: update commit refs for vyos1x-config and libvyosconfig
2023-02-11 13:18:32 -06:00